    6 Considerations for Protecting Beneficiaries’ Interests

    StreamlineBy StreamlineJuly 21, 2026

    pexels

    Protecting beneficiaries’ interests requires thoughtful planning, clear documentation, and a long term strategy that anticipates both financial and personal needs. Whether an estate involves complex assets, multiple heirs, or evolving family dynamics, the goal is to ensure that beneficiaries receive what was intended for them with minimal conflict and maximum clarity. Strong protection begins with understanding how legal tools, communication practices, and professional guidance work together to support smooth administration and long term stability.

    Establishing Clear and Updated Estate Documents

    Well structured estate documents form the foundation of beneficiary protection. Wills, trusts, and related directives must be drafted clearly to reflect the grantor’s intentions and minimize ambiguity. Over time, life changes such as marriage, divorce, new children, or shifting financial circumstances may require updates to ensure that documents remain accurate. Regular review helps prevent outdated instructions from creating confusion or disputes. When estate documents are kept current, beneficiaries gain stronger assurance that their interests are represented accurately and consistently.

    Strengthening Asset Organization and Financial Transparency

    Organized financial records make estate administration significantly easier and reduce the likelihood of delays or misunderstandings. Clear documentation of accounts, property titles, insurance policies, and investment holdings ensures that beneficiaries and administrators understand the full scope of the estate. Transparency also supports smoother transitions by reducing the risk of overlooked assets or conflicting information. When assets are organized effectively, beneficiaries benefit from a more predictable and efficient process.

    Implementing Trust Structures for Long Term Protection

    Trusts offer valuable tools for protecting beneficiaries’ interests, especially when long term management or specific distribution conditions are needed. A trust can help control how and when assets are distributed, provide oversight for minors or individuals with special needs, and reduce exposure to potential financial risks. Trusts also offer privacy and may help streamline administration by avoiding certain court processes. By selecting the right trust structure and ensuring it aligns with the grantor’s goals, families create a framework that supports stability and long term protection for beneficiaries.

    Reducing Conflict Through Clear Communication and Expectations

    Family communication plays an important role in protecting beneficiaries’ interests. While estate planning documents provide legal clarity, open conversations help reduce emotional misunderstandings and prevent future disputes. Discussing intentions, responsibilities, and expectations allows beneficiaries to understand the reasoning behind decisions and prepares them for their roles in the administration process. Clear communication also helps reduce stress during transitions by ensuring that everyone is aware of the plan and the steps involved. When families communicate openly, beneficiaries experience fewer surprises and greater confidence in the estate’s structure.

    Preparing Executors and Trustees for Their Responsibilities

    Executors and trustees play a central role in protecting beneficiaries’ interests. Their ability to manage assets, follow legal requirements, and uphold the grantor’s intentions directly influences the outcome of the estate. Preparing these individuals through clear instructions, organized documentation, and professional guidance helps ensure that they can fulfill their responsibilities effectively. Executors and trustees benefit from understanding timelines, administrative duties, and the importance of impartial decision making. When these roles are supported properly, beneficiaries receive more reliable and consistent protection.

    Incorporating Professional Guidance for Complex Situations

    Professional support strengthens beneficiary protection by ensuring that estate plans comply with legal requirements and reflect best practices. Attorneys, financial advisors, and tax professionals help families navigate complex decisions, reduce administrative burdens, and anticipate potential challenges. Their expertise provides clarity in areas such as asset distribution, tax obligations, and long term planning strategies. Professional guidance also helps families avoid common mistakes that may lead to disputes or unintended outcomes. When experts are involved, beneficiaries benefit from a more secure and well structured estate plan.

    Conclusion

    Protecting beneficiaries’ interests requires clear documentation, organized assets, thoughtful trust structures, strong communication, prepared administrators, and professional guidance. When these considerations are addressed with care, families create an estate plan that supports stability, reduces conflict, and ensures that beneficiaries receive the protection and clarity they deserve.
